For those hoping to shoot some hoops on the next-gen version of NBA 2K21, you may want to be sure you have enough space as it has been confirmed that the PS5 version will require a minimum of 150GB!

Amazon has shipped early copies of NBA 2K21 for the PS5, which an image was shared by Robo3687 over on reddit of the backside of the case.

As you can see from the requirements, the PS5 version will need a minimum of 150GB in order to be installed. For comparison the PS4 version currently weighs in around 42 to 50GB, meaning the PS4 version is 3 times the size. Though it’s important to note that this listed number on box cases has always somewhat been misleading in the past, at least for PS4 games as they are generally larger than the actually file size.

This may be the case, as the Xbox Series X version is reasonably smaller, clocking in at just 72GB for our download.

Of course we’ll know the true size of the PS5 version here real soon as the title will become available to download the same day as the PS5 launch, which is November 12. We’ll be sure to update this post if the size differs, but for now just be prepared for the game to take up a large chunk of your SSD.
